Process

1. Traditional Liposuction:Traditional liposuction involves the use of a cannula (a thin tube) inserted through small incisions to suction out fat. The fat is usually broken up using either a manual or mechanical method before being removed. While effective, this method can be invasive and may require longer recovery times.

2. Tumescent Liposuction:Tumescent liposuction is a refined version where a large volume of diluted local anesthesia is injected into the treatment area. This method reduces blood loss and post-operative pain, leading to a quicker recovery. The anesthetic fluid also helps to swell the fat tissue, making it easier to suction out.

3. Ultrasound-Assisted Liposuction (UAL):UAL uses ultrasound energy to liquefy fat cells before suctioning them out. This technique improves fat removal efficiency and can be particularly useful for areas with fibrous fat. UAL also helps in contouring and reduces the risk of uneven results.

4. Laser-Assisted Liposuction (LAL):Laser-assisted liposuction utilizes laser energy to liquefy fat cells, which are then removed through a cannula. The laser also stimulates collagen production, leading to tighter skin post-procedure. LAL is known for its precision and ability to treat smaller areas with minimal downtime.

5. Radiofrequency-Assisted Liposuction (RFAL):RFAL employs radiofrequency energy to heat and liquefy fat before removal. This technique also promotes skin tightening by stimulating collagen production. RFAL is ideal for treating areas with loose skin and can result in a smoother contour.

6. Power-Assisted Liposuction (PAL):PAL uses a vibrating cannula to break up fat cells more efficiently, reducing the physical effort required from the surgeon. This method can enhance precision and is beneficial for large-volume fat removal.


Benefits

1. Minimally Invasive:Many of the modern liposuction techniques are less invasive compared to traditional methods. Techniques like laser and radiofrequency-assisted liposuction reduce the need for large incisions, leading to less scarring and quicker recovery times.

2. Enhanced Precision:Innovative technologies such as ultrasound and laser-assisted liposuction offer greater precision in fat removal. This precision helps in achieving more refined and natural-looking results, particularly in areas that are challenging to contour.

3. Improved Safety:Advancements in liposuction techniques, including the use of tumescent fluid and advanced energy sources, have improved patient safety. These innovations reduce the risk of complications such as excessive bleeding, infection, and prolonged recovery.

4. Reduced Recovery Time:Techniques that minimize invasiveness and improve fat removal efficiency contribute to faster recovery times. Patients often experience less pain and swelling and can return to their daily activities sooner.

5. Skin Tightening:Certain techniques like laser and radiofrequency-assisted liposuction not only remove fat but also stimulate collagen production, resulting in improved skin tightness and texture. This dual benefit enhances the overall aesthetic outcome.

6. Customized Treatment:Modern liposuction techniques allow for greater customization based on individual patient needs. Surgeons can tailor the procedure to address specific problem areas and achieve optimal results, improving overall patient satisfaction.
